#ba6037 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ba6037 is composed of 72.9% red, 37.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#ba6037 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c06e with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#ba6037 color description : Moderate orange.
#ba6037 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ba6037 has RGB values of R:186, G:96,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.7,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12214327.

Shades and Tints of #ba6037
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ba6037
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797878 is the less saturated color, while #e84f09 is the most saturated one.
